The Role of Protein in Pre-Workout Nutrition
Protein is a crucial macronutrient that plays a vital role in muscle repair, growth, and overall recovery. Consuming protein before a workout provides your body with the amino acids needed to minimize muscle breakdown during exercise. Unlike carbohydrates, which primarily fuel your workout by providing quick energy, protein works behind the scenes by supporting muscle integrity and preparing your body to recover faster.
When you eat protein prior to training, you’re essentially giving your muscles the building blocks they need to withstand the stress of physical activity. This can be especially important for strength training or resistance exercises where muscle fibers undergo micro-tears that require repair. Without adequate protein intake before working out, your body may rely more heavily on breaking down existing muscle tissue for fuel.
Moreover, protein helps regulate blood sugar levels when paired with carbohydrates. This stabilizes energy release throughout your session, preventing those mid-workout energy slumps many athletes dread. Thus, incorporating protein into your pre-workout meal can lead to sustained performance and better endurance.
Timing Matters: When Should You Eat Protein Before Workout?
The timing of consuming protein is just as important as the amount. Ideally, eating protein 30 minutes to 2 hours before exercise allows enough time for digestion and absorption of amino acids into the bloodstream. This window ensures that your muscles have access to these nutrients right when they need them most.
If you eat too close to working out—say within 15 minutes—your body might still be busy digesting food rather than focusing fully on exercise. This can lead to discomfort such as bloating or sluggishness during intense activity. On the flip side, consuming protein too far ahead (more than 3 hours) may mean amino acid levels decline before exercise starts.
For those who train early in the morning or have tight schedules, a quick protein shake or bar 20-30 minutes prior can be an effective option. These are easier to digest and provide rapid delivery of essential nutrients without weighing you down.
Pre-Workout Protein Sources
Choosing the right kind of protein before working out depends on personal preference and digestion tolerance. Here are common sources that work well:
- Whey Protein: Fast-digesting and rich in branched-chain amino acids (BCAAs), it quickly supplies muscles with essential nutrients.
- Greek Yogurt: Contains both protein and some carbs; easy on the stomach.
- Eggs: Whole eggs or egg whites provide high-quality complete proteins.
- Cottage Cheese: A slow-digesting option that still works if consumed earlier.
- Lean Meat or Poultry: Suitable if eaten 1-2 hours before training but less ideal immediately pre-workout due to slower digestion.
Combining these proteins with some complex carbohydrates like oats or fruit can enhance energy availability while maintaining steady blood sugar levels.
The Science Behind Protein Intake Before Exercise
Research shows that consuming protein before exercise can reduce muscle damage and improve recovery markers post-workout. A study published in the Journal of the International Society of Sports Nutrition found that participants who ingested whey protein prior to resistance training experienced less muscle soreness and better strength retention compared to those who did not.
Protein intake stimulates muscle protein synthesis (MPS), which is crucial for repairing micro-tears caused by intense activity. Pre-exercise amino acid availability primes this process so it kicks off immediately during and after training sessions.
Another benefit lies in how pre-workout protein influences metabolism. It can increase thermogenesis—the number of calories burned during digestion—and help maintain lean body mass while promoting fat loss when combined with regular exercise.
However, it’s important not to overlook carbohydrates’ role alongside protein since they remain primary fuel sources for high-intensity workouts. The synergy between carbs and proteins maximizes performance outcomes more than either macronutrient alone.
A Balanced Macronutrient Approach
Here’s an example breakdown of an ideal pre-workout meal composition:
| Nutrient | Function | Example Foods |
|---|---|---|
| Protein (15-25g) | Sustains muscle repair & reduces breakdown | Whey shake, eggs, Greek yogurt, lean chicken breast |
| Carbohydrates (30-50g) | Main energy source; maintains blood glucose levels | Oats, bananas, whole grain bread, sweet potatoes |
| Fats (5-10g) | Sustains longer-term energy & hormone balance | Nuts, avocado slices, olive oil drizzle |
This combination fuels muscles efficiently while preventing fatigue or hunger pangs mid-session.
The Impact of Protein Type on Workout Performance
Not all proteins digest at the same rate or contain identical amino acid profiles. The speed at which a protein breaks down affects how quickly its nutrients become available during exercise.
- Fast-Digesting Proteins: Whey is king here due to its rapid absorption within about 20-30 minutes after ingestion. It spikes plasma amino acid levels quickly and supports immediate muscle needs.
- Slow-Digesting Proteins: Casein digests over several hours providing a steady release of amino acids but may be less effective right before workouts unless consumed well in advance.
- Plant-Based Proteins: Pea, rice, hemp proteins tend to digest slower than whey but are excellent alternatives for vegetarians or vegans when combined properly for complete amino acid profiles.
- Mixed Proteins: Combining fast and slow proteins could offer sustained benefits throughout longer training sessions.
Understanding these differences helps tailor pre-workout nutrition based on workout intensity and duration.
The Role of Protein in Different Types of Workouts
Strength Training & Muscle Building
Protein intake before lifting weights is particularly beneficial because it directly impacts muscle synthesis rates during resistance training sessions. Consuming adequate protein beforehand reduces catabolism—the breakdown of existing muscle fibers—and primes anabolic pathways for growth post-exercise.
Studies show strength athletes who consume 20-30 grams of high-quality protein pre-workout experience improved strength gains over time compared to those who skip it.
Endurance Training & Cardio Workouts
While carbohydrates dominate endurance nutrition strategies due to their quick energy release properties, adding moderate amounts of protein prior has advantages too. It helps reduce muscle damage from prolonged exertion and supports recovery afterward.
For runners or cyclists engaging in long-distance efforts lasting over an hour, including 10-15 grams of easily digestible protein alongside carbs can lower markers of inflammation and soreness after finishing.
High-Intensity Interval Training (HIIT)
HIIT involves repeated bursts of intense effort followed by short rest periods—a demanding workout style that stresses both aerobic and anaerobic systems. Pre-workout proteins supply amino acids required for quick recovery between intervals while maintaining lean mass under stress.
A small whey-based snack about 45 minutes before HIIT sessions improves performance output without causing digestive discomfort during rapid movements.
The Debate: Is It Okay To Eat Protein Before Workout?
Some argue that eating any solid food close to exercise might cause gastrointestinal distress or sluggishness due to diverted blood flow toward digestion instead of muscles. However, this depends largely on individual tolerance levels and meal composition.
Consuming a balanced meal containing moderate amounts of quality protein about 1-2 hours prior generally avoids these issues while maximizing benefits. For others sensitive to heavy foods pre-exercise, liquid options like shakes offer a convenient alternative with minimal digestive load.
Scientific consensus supports eating some form of protein before workouts rather than skipping it altogether—especially if workouts exceed moderate intensity or last longer than 45 minutes.
Nutritional Strategies for Optimal Pre-Workout Protein Intake
- Aim for 20–30 grams per serving: This range effectively stimulates muscle repair mechanisms without overloading digestion.
- Avoid high-fat meals immediately before training: Fat slows gastric emptying which may cause discomfort during exercise.
- Add carbohydrates: Pairing proteins with carbs improves glycogen stores fueling immediate energy demands.
- Tune into your body: Everyone digests differently—experiment with timing and types until you find what feels best.
- If short on time: Liquid shakes or bars containing fast-digesting proteins like whey provide quick nourishment without heaviness.
- Avoid excessive fiber right before workouts: Fiber delays digestion which could impair nutrient availability during activity.
- If exercising early morning: A small snack such as Greek yogurt plus fruit works well if full breakfast isn’t feasible beforehand.
